I have decided to stop further maintenance of FSCONV. You can of course continue to use it, there are no bugs pending. If you're happy with it, just stay with it, I'd 'say.

But there is good news too: The successor of FSCONV is called lekyoucon, a beta version is available for download now. It is a simplified but still powerful version of FSCONV, there are 138 offset(-group)s; each can be activated individually in the lekyoucon.ini file.

The advantage of this new strategy is, that it will be easier for me to adapt lekyoucon (as a member of the lek-X-con program family) to a Level-D 757, if and when it will be released...
